After a bit of searching, I believe I have finally found a code base which I'm relatively happy with. MudOS accompanied with the Lima Bean Mudlib is a bare bones LPC based MUD with enough examples to get me started, but not so much built in that it can't more easily be customised to my needs. More news to follow as I develop ideas on the world and general workings of Kelianon itself.
